Best practices for sustainable resource procurement in purchasing departments

Understanding Sustainable Resource Procurement

Sustainable resource procurement is a method of sourcing materials that consider environmental, social, and economic impacts throughout the purchasing process.
This approach ensures that the goods and services procured are sustainable, meaning they do not deplete resources or harm the planet irreversibly.
Incorporating sustainability into procurement strategies is becoming essential as businesses recognize the importance of contributing to a healthier planet and society.

The Importance of Sustainable Procurement

The world’s resources are finite, and the rapid depletion poses significant risks for future generations.
Procurement departments play a crucial role in addressing this issue, as they decide which products and suppliers to use.
By opting for sustainable procurement practices, businesses can minimize their impact on the environment, reduce costs over time, and boost their reputation among consumers and stakeholders.

Sustainable procurement is also a strategic tool that can drive innovation and efficiency within operations.
It encourages organizations to look for ways to optimize their supply chains, reduce waste, and implement innovative solutions that can lead to long-term benefits.

Key Principles of Sustainable Procurement

To ensure sustainable resource procurement, purchasing departments should adhere to several key principles.

Environmental Considerations

Environmental considerations should be at the forefront of procurement strategies.
This includes assessing the environmental impact of goods and services throughout their life cycle, from raw material extraction to disposal.
Purchasers should prioritize products that use renewable resources, are energy-efficient, and have minimal environmental footprint.

Social Responsibility

Procurement departments should also focus on social aspects, such as fair labor practices, community impact, and human rights.
Evaluating suppliers based on their social responsibility policies can help ensure that procurement decisions promote positive social outcomes.

Economic Viability

While environmental and social considerations are crucial, procurement strategies must also be economically viable.
This involves evaluating the total cost of ownership over the product’s lifetime, not just the initial price.
Sustainable procurement should deliver long-term cost savings through improved efficiency, reduced waste, and better resource management.

Steps to Implement Sustainable Procurement Practices

Transitioning to sustainable resource procurement requires a structured approach.
Here are some steps purchasing departments can take to facilitate this transition.

Develop a Clear Policy

Begin with developing a comprehensive sustainable procurement policy that outlines the organization’s commitment to sustainable practices.
This policy should define goals, objectives, and key performance indicators to measure success.

Engage with Stakeholders

Involve stakeholders from across the organization, including suppliers, employees, and customers, in the planning process.
Engaging with these groups can provide valuable insights and foster a culture of sustainability throughout the supply chain.

Evaluate Suppliers

Supplier selection is a critical component of sustainable procurement.
Assess potential suppliers based on their sustainability credentials, including environmental certifications, labor practices, and transparency.
Consider working with suppliers who share your sustainability goals, as this partnership can drive mutual benefits.

Use Technology to Enhance Transparency

Implement technologies that improve supply chain transparency and traceability.
Digital tools can help monitor and measure the sustainability impacts of procurement decisions, ensuring compliance with sustainability objectives.

Challenges in Sustainable Procurement

Despite the benefits, there are challenges associated with implementing sustainable procurement practices.
Purchasing departments need to be aware of these obstacles to address them effectively.

Cost Concerns

Sustainable products can have higher upfront costs, which might deter some organizations.
However, it’s important to consider the long-term savings and value associated with these products due to their efficiency and durability.

Lack of Supplier Awareness

Another common challenge is the lack of awareness or commitment among suppliers.
Businesses may need to work closely with their suppliers to ensure alignment between environmental and social goals.

Complexity in Implementation

Implementing sustainable procurement requires significant changes in processes, which can be complex and resource-intensive.
Organizations may need to invest in training and resources to ensure a smooth transition.

The Future of Sustainable Procurement

As environmental, social, and economic issues become more pressing, the importance of sustainable resource procurement will only increase.
Organizations will need to continuously innovate and adapt their strategies to remain competitive and sustainable.

Embracing Innovation

In the future, new technologies and innovations will play a crucial role in advancing sustainable procurement.
Artificial intelligence, blockchain, and big data analytics can drive further transparency, efficiency, and accountability in supply chains.

Building Stronger Partnerships

Collaboration between businesses, governments, and non-governmental organizations will be vital to establishing global standards and frameworks that support sustainable procurement.
Building stronger partnerships can lead to shared best practices and drive collective action towards common goals.

In conclusion, sustainable resource procurement is not just a trend but a necessity for businesses looking to thrive in the modern world.
By adopting best practices and overcoming challenges, procurement departments can significantly impact the triple bottom line—people, planet, and profit—while ensuring long-term success and sustainability.
